Output 21c4aadb63ef67c79dc2367d366d49736135b277999ce2456401209480b142e9:0

value
18455717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db80c55345cb4ef709aaca7ea1b68a7213495f0e OP_EQUAL
address
3MheAhwsuxYf6sGPbgWEch5tMkqa4ZRpPT
transaction
21c4aadb63ef67c79dc2367d366d49736135b277999ce2456401209480b142e9
spent
true